在工业自动化领域,PLC(可编程逻辑控制器)扮演着至关重要的角色,而 PLC 编程中的算法则是实现各种控制功能的核心。接下来,就让我用 1 分钟带您快速了解一下 PLC 编程算法。

首先,顺序控制算法是 PLC 编程中最基础也是最常用的算法之一。它按照预先设定的顺序,依次执行各个操作步骤,适用于那些具有明确先后顺序的控制任务,比如生产线上的加工流程。

打开网易新闻 查看精彩图片

然后是逻辑控制算法,通过与、或、非等逻辑运算,对输入信号进行处理,以决定输出信号的状态。这种算法常用于实现简单的开关控制、联锁保护等功能。

PID(比例 - 积分 - 微分)控制算法在工业控制中应用广泛。它根据系统的误差,通过比例、积分和微分三个环节的运算,计算出控制量,用于精确地调节温度、压力、流量等过程变量,使系统能够稳定、快速地达到预期的目标值。

模糊控制算法则是一种基于模糊逻辑的控制方法。它将输入变量模糊化,根据模糊规则进行推理,最后得到模糊的输出结果,再将其清晰化得到实际的控制量。这种算法适用于那些难以建立精确数学模型的复杂系统的控制。

打开网易新闻 查看精彩图片

此外,还有一些高级算法如神经网络算法、遗传算法等,也逐渐被应用到 PLC 编程中,以实现更加智能、高效的控制功能。

总之,PLC 编程算法种类繁多,每种算法都有其适用的场景和优势。了解并掌握这些算法,对于提升 PLC 编程水平,实现高效、精确的工业自动化控制具有重要意义。